收藏
回答

安卓机上getClipboardData不是每一次都能获取内容?

我在 app.js 中使用 wx.getClipboardData 获取设备剪贴板内容,iPhone 上每一次都可以成功,但是安卓机上不是每一次都能访问成功,经常出现访问到的内容是“空串”。但是确实是进入了 success 回调,表示是获取剪贴板内容成功了,只是获取的内容是空串。请问有没有大佬遇到过类似情况,是什么原因呢,要怎么处理这个情况呢?

回答关注问题邀请回答
收藏

2 个回答

  • 社区技术运营专员-许涛
    社区技术运营专员-许涛
    2020-12-24

    你好,麻烦提供出现问题的具体机型、微信版本号、系统版本号,以及能复现问题的代码片段(https://developers.weixin.qq.com/miniprogram/dev/devtools/minicode.html)

    2020-12-24
    有用
    回复
  • 朝阳
    朝阳
    2020-12-24

    我觉得可能是你传值的问题,说不定你传值就传了一个空串?

    2020-12-24
    有用
    回复 4
    • 阳阳阳
      阳阳阳
      2020-12-24
      但是这个是使用微信提供的 API 直接访问设备剪贴板,我只是使用了 getClipboardData,没有使用 setClipboardData。而且我这边又反复测试几次,发现同样的剪贴板内容,在连续多次调用 wx.getClipboardData 有时可以获取到内容,有时是空串,没有规律。
      2020-12-24
      回复
    • 朝阳
      朝阳
      2020-12-24回复阳阳阳
      不好意思看错了,我以为是set😁,getClipboardData没用过
      2020-12-24
      回复
    • 阳阳阳
      阳阳阳
      2020-12-24回复朝阳
      这个只在安卓机上有这个问题。。。
      2020-12-24
      回复
    • 朝阳
      朝阳
      2020-12-24回复阳阳阳
      我看相关问题好像确实有这个毛病
      2020-12-24
      回复
登录 后发表内容
问题标签